Though the engines will run on biofuels, should the need arise they can switch to marine diesel.</description><feedburner:origLink>http://www.plateforme-biocarburants.ch/actualites/index.php?id=6939</feedburner:origLink></item><item><title>Biofuel use in Germany plunges as oilseeds gain</title><link>http://feedproxy.google.com/~r/plateforme-biocarburants_all/~3/EoZSvkSv_BE/index.php</link><pubDate>Sat, 09 Jul 2011 09:43:01 +0100</pubDate><description>Biofuel consumption in Germany declined 18% in April because of scarce supplies and rising prices for rapeseed and oil made from the seed, Hamburg-based oilseeds analyst Oil World said. Blenders mixed less biodiesel with regular fuel as the price of rapeseed gained 33% in the past year, Oil World said today in a report. Ethanol mixed into fuel fell by 11% in the year through April as Germans shunned the product, according to the report. Biofuel production totaled 194'000 tons in April, down from 238'000 tons a year earlier, the researcher said. "Demand for certified rapeseed oil mainly of German origin for biodiesel production reportedly increased to record levels", Oil World said. "The declining usage of biodiesel is largely attributable to scarce supplies and high prices of rapeseed and rapeseed oil."</description><feedburner:origLink>http://www.plateforme-biocarburants.ch/actualites/index.php?id=6938</feedburner:origLink></item><item><title>La récolte d'été bénéfique pour l'algo-carburant</title><link>http://feedproxy.google.com/~r/plateforme-biocarburants_all/~3/AS7QR_DIL5I/index.php</link><pubDate>Thu, 07 Jul 2011 10:45:53 +0100</pubDate><description>La culture du varech (Laminaria digitata), encore appelé goémon (algue de couleur brune), pourrait s'avérer être une alternative intéressante face à la biomasse terrestre, pour produire du biocarburant, à condition de profiter pleinement de son potentiel chimique au bon moment. En effet, la récolte du varech en juillet permettrait d'assurer une libération optimale du sucre quand les teneurs en glucides sont à leur plus haut. "Les glucides et les sucres solubles sont stockables et restent convertibles en éthanol dans un processus de fermentation, donc nous devons y recourir autant que se faire", a expliqué le Dr Jessica Adams, chercheur principal à l'Université d'Aberystwyth. "Les métaux peuvent également inhiber la fermentation, c'est pourquoi nous voulons un taux le plus faible qu'il soit." Après avoir prélevé tous les mois, des échantillons de laminaires sur les côtes galloises, les chercheurs l'ont analysé chimiquement dans le but d'évaluer la variabilité saisonnière. Leurs résultats qui ont été présentés le 4 Juillet 2011, à la Conférence annuelle des expériences biologiques à Glasgow, ont montré que juillet restait le meilleur mois pour une récolte en vue d'une production de biocarburants, quand le varech contient les plus fortes proportions de glucides pour une teneur en métal la plus faible possible.</description><feedburner:origLink>http://www.plateforme-biocarburants.ch/actualites/index.php?id=6937</feedburner:origLink></item><item><title>L'aéronautique en quête de biocarburants durables</title><link>http://feedproxy.google.com/~r/plateforme-biocarburants_all/~3/OIVPmdv4GEI/index.php</link><pubDate>Wed, 06 Jul 2011 09:54:21 +0100</pubDate><description>Si l'avion Solar Impulse a réalisé le mois dernier son premier vol presque exclusivement solaire pour l'inauguration du Salon International de l'Aéronautique et de l'Espace à Paris, ce sont les biocarburants qui ont marqué un tournant dans l'histoire du salon et de l'aéronautique. Car, s'il existe déjà des certifications de biocarburants - un Boeing 747-8 Freighter réalisait récemment le premier vol transatlantique au biocarburant - on en est encore à l'étape artisanale.</description><feedburner:origLink>http://www.plateforme-biocarburants.ch/actualites/index.php?id=6936</feedburner:origLink></item><item><title>Have biofuels caused indirect land use change?</title><link>http://feedproxy.google.com/~r/plateforme-biocarburants_all/~3/vMCpM3bnKvk/index.php</link><pubDate>Wed, 06 Jul 2011 09:51:54 +0100</pubDate><description>International change in land use has been a careful consideration in the cost and benefit analysis of biofuel production. Indirect Land Use Change (iLUC) is the term many experts use in discussion of this topic. The general idea of iLUC is that natural areas across the globe may be converted to cropland to replace crops that are being used to produce biofuels. While this topic seems relatively clear at first glance, it is complicated by factors such as the type of ecosystem that is being converted, such as forest and grassland. Therefore, assumptions are used in predicting the change in land use. Extensive computer models use different assumptions which result in a wide range of predictions. A recent article published in Biomass and Bioenergy (2011), authored by Bruce Dale and Kim Seungdo from Michigan State University, discusses iLUC using historical data and very limited assumptions.</description><feedburner:origLink>http://www.plateforme-biocarburants.ch/actualites/index.php?id=6935</feedburner:origLink></item><item><title>Petrobras expands in biofuel world</title><link>http://feedproxy.google.com/~r/plateforme-biocarburants_all/~3/ow6T5iIq7sk/index.php</link><pubDate>Wed, 06 Jul 2011 09:50:43 +0100</pubDate><description>Brazilian state-run energy firm Petroleo Brasileiro S.A. or Petrobras acquired a 50% stake in a local biodiesel company BSBIOS Industria e Comercio de Biodiesel Sul Brasil S.A. for 200 million Brazilian reals or $128.4 million. The unit is well connected by railroad terminals and a distribution base for smooth delivery and marketing of biodiesel.</description><feedburner:origLink>http://www.plateforme-biocarburants.ch/actualites/index.php?id=6934</feedburner:origLink></item><item><title>Canada: Entrée en vigueur de l'exigence relative au biodiesel</title><link>http://feedproxy.google.com/~r/plateforme-biocarburants_all/~3/n-7uARDoTxA/index.php</link><pubDate>Wed, 06 Jul 2011 09:49:06 +0100</pubDate><description>Ottawa va de l'avant avec l'exigence d'une teneur de 2% en carburant renouvelable dans le carburant diesel et le mazout de chauffage. Si l'exigence est entrée en vigueur le 1er juillet dernier, celle-ci comporte certaines exemptions. Soulignant les "problèmes logistiques" relatifs au mélange de biodiesel à Terre-Neuve-et-Labrador, une exemption permanente est accordée en ce qui concerne la teneur en carburant renouvelable dans le carburant diesel et le mazout de chauffage vendus dans cette région. Du côté du carburant diesel et du mazout de chauffage vendus au Québec et dans les provinces de l'Atlantique, des exemptions temporaires au sujet de la teneur en carburant renouvelable seront accordées jusqu'au 31 décembre 2012. Les raffineries de l'Est disposeront ainsi d'une période de 18 mois pour l'installation de l'infrastructure de mélange du biodiesel.</description><feedburner:origLink>http://www.plateforme-biocarburants.ch/actualites/index.php?id=6933</feedburner:origLink></item><item><title>Petrobras acquires 50% stake in biodiesel producer</title><link>http://feedproxy.google.com/~r/plateforme-biocarburants_all/~3/5h_WYIHm_sY/index.php</link><pubDate>Mon, 04 Jul 2011 21:02:21 +0100</pubDate><description>In Brazil, a wholly owned subsidiary of energy giant Petrobras, Petrobras Biocombustível S.A. - Pbio, has purchased a 50% stake in a biodiesel plant for $128 million (€88 million).
